The One for All Allotment Sessions will take place in Brighton on 6 September 2026. The event is designed for and by neurodivergent people and will feature allotment sessions in nature. The event is free to attend.
Immerse yourself in nature and creativity with our allotment sessions, designed for and by neurodivergent people.
We would like to welcome you to One for All Forest School, an inclusive and therapeutic forest school created by and for neurodivergent people.
Join us on our new allotment adventure. This is a new site, and we are starting from the beginning. These sessions will be an opportunity to share skills, build knowledge and develop the site as a community. There are no expectations or plans. We will build this space together!
Where possible we will provide warm drinks and light snacks. Whilst these sessions have no structure there will be opportunities to develop forest school skills, with specialist guest visits to share skills and knowledge.
From September 2026, our allotment will be open on the 1st and 3rd Sunday of the month between 10am-1pm. Arrive and leave when you want.
Please note that site does not have any toilets. The nearest toilets are a 10–15-minute walk to Bevendean Gardens.

Safe Space Statement
This is a safe space for everyone to participate, regardless of background or identity. We encourage open communication and mutual respect. Bullying, intimidation, or harassment of any kind will not be tolerated.
This is a safe space for self-identifying LGBTQ+ people. We respect all sexual orientations, gender identities, trans statuses, and expressions. We aim to foster a non-judgmental community free from sexual harassment, unwanted touching, or derogatory language.
